Dawn of HOLO: More Than Just a Token
HoloworldAI isn’t just another platform promising fancy AI; it's a vibrant ecosystem combining agents, creators, and community in one open economy. The core idea revolves around giving everyone, not just developers or big studios, access to create, trade, and deploy AI agents — characters, virtual beings, IPs — that can talk, act, and engage. (Binance Academy)
These agents are registered on the Solana blockchain, giving verifiable ownership. When you create an agent, you own something real, digital yet traceable. No more “it was built by someone else” — yours is yours. (MEXC)
HOLO, the token, forms the backbone of this universe. It’s used in staking, governance, creator incentives, and as the currency inside the Holoworld Open MCP network. If you’re contributing (building agents, creating content, participating in launches), HOLO rewards you and gives you a voice in how the platform evolves. (Binance Academy)
The Fair Launch: Leveling the Playing Field
What’s special about HOLO’s introduction is how careful HoloworldAI has been to make the launch equitable. No bots, no gas wars, no unfair allocations. The launch was done through Hololaunch, meant to ensure access is fair to all. (MEXC)
The total supply of HOLO is about 2,048,000,000 tokens, with a portion set aside for creator incentives, ecosystem growth, and community rewards. On listing, less than 20% of that supply was circulating, which is sizeable but still leaves room for growth and participation. (CoinCarp)
A Milestone: HOLO on Binance
A major turning point arrived on September 11, 2025. That’s when HOLO became tradable on Binance Alpha. This was more than just “another token listing.” For HoloworldAI, it meant that the ideas they’ve been developing could reach a wider audience. Binance users who had participated in Pre-TGE (Pre-Token Generation Event) or in the Booster campaigns got early access or rewards. (Coin Gabbar)
Binance also included HOLO in its HODLer Airdrops program, giving holders an extra incentive to hold and engage with the project. (Binance Academy)
